Reporting to the Chief Medical Officer, the Medical Director, Clinical Informatics will be responsible for supporting delivery of content that forms the clinical knowledge base of Availity’s clinical decision support tools. Specifically, the Medical Director will provide input and oversight for the interpretation of external clinical content (e.g., medical policies, clinical guidelines, and reimbursement policies) the construction and maintenance of AI-enabled attestation trees reflecting applicable clinical content, and clinical validation of the platform overall. The Medical Director will also be responsible for supporting development of additional use cases, supporting customer interactions and engaging in cross-functional collaboration with Product, Engineering, and Clinical Informatics peers. The role requires an in-depth knowledge of utilization management principles, the purpose and function of medical necessity guidelines, and prior authorization adjudication practices. This person will work in a team environment and will be expected to perform complex tasks while collaborating with colleagues with clinical and engineering/programming backgrounds. Providing oversight and input to the extended clinical team throughout the product development process from the point of initial review of medical policy through the release of AI-enabled attestation trees into production. This entails developing a working knowledge of a domain-specific programming language and use of development tools to assign coded medical constructs to attestation trees to facilitate automation of their responses. Guiding clinical oversight for teams responsible for building and maintaining clinical content attestation questions, decision pathways, and recommendation logic that accurately reflect medical policy or other clinical guidelines requirements. Timely support of all assigned tasks related to the delivery of clinical decision support tools, including decision tree creation, clinical concept labeling, and clinical performance validation. Reviewing audit findings, customer feedback, and implementation observations to identify opportunities for decision tree improvement and providing input to enhance validity and accuracy of the AI outputs, including identification of additional medical terms that should be added to the existing vocabulary of coded concepts. Contributing thought leadership, clinical design, and operational support for innovation initiatives (e.g., alpha/beta customer support) and other product enhancement efforts and feature development. Advising on clinical guidance and support to Product, Engineering and customer-facing teams (e.g., implementation, sales and account teams) regarding decision tree behavior, policy/guidelines interpretation, and clinical workflow considerations. Occasionally serving as clinical liaison to the medical policy and utilization management teams at current customers, including serving as a non-voting member of their medical policy committees.
